Transaction 03708bfae4607fbd714f14bd281d1cbced594a318a7f48c1167355107b95cf01
1 Input
2 Outputs
- 03708bfae4607fbd714f14bd281d1cbced594a318a7f48c1167355107b95cf01:0
- 03708bfae4607fbd714f14bd281d1cbced594a318a7f48c1167355107b95cf01:1
value 786027
address 3A3SePZvufDdRPBa1aJCF4qP4pv2qMLMFC
value 73317017
address 13r8THqqmJ999uHXmoYVwsDSektuURAQSF